Factors Affecting Cost
- Window Size: Larger windows generally cost more due to increased material and labor requirements.
- Window Type: Different types of windows, such as double-hung, casement, or bay windows, have varying costs.
- Material: The choice of material (wood, vinyl, aluminum, etc.) can significantly affect the overall cost.
- Labor: Labor costs can vary based on the complexity of the installation and the expertise of the contractor.
- Permits and Inspections: Local building codes may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Customization: Custom-designed windows or unique architectural features can increase costs.
- Energy Efficiency: Windows with higher energy efficiency ratings often come at a premium but can save money in the long run.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Standard Dormer Window Replacement |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Custom Dormer Window Installation | $3,000 - $5,000 |
Labor Costs (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$300 |
Energy-Efficient Window Upgrade | Additional $200 - $600 per window |
